Cross-species rescue of fibrin deposition in f8–/–;at3–/– larvae by FVIII and VWF. (A) Model demonstrating the effect of FVIII levels on fibrin deposition. (B) f8–/–;at3–/– zebrafish larvae were injected with various combinations of plasmids encoding human (h) and zebrafish (z) FVIII and VWF and analyzed for fibrin deposition at 5 dpf by an observer blinded to condition. Injection groups included: uninjected controls, hVWF, hF8, zvwf, zf8, coinjection of hVWF + hF8, coinjection of zvwf + zf8, and cross-species combinations (hVWF + zf8 and zvwf + hF8). (C) Comparison of various groups shows that hVWF, but not zvwf, enhances fibrin deposition in combination with human or fish FVIII. Statistical analysis was performed using ordinal logistic regression followed by Dunnett's adjustments. (∗P < .05, ∗∗P < .01, ∗∗∗P < .001). ns, nonsignificant.
